* Summary:

** The role involves working for Northern Trust Hedge Fund Services (HFS), a global fund administrator, specializing in complex hedge funds and alternative asset investments.  The successful candidate will be an ambitious self-starter who has demonstrated the ability to function as an effective and strategic leader/manager in a dynamic, fast paced, and demanding environment.  This individual will have a strong technical background, experience working within the Technology industry and a proven track record of solving business problems.  

The role will be a key part of our hedge fund administration business and will be visible to many teams and partners.

This role is responsible for Release Management within HFS Omnium Change Management team. This team is responsible for coordinating changes ensuring stability for the Omnium Platform. The Release Management role works closely with the Product Owners and Development teams responsible for executing on product-focused visions aligned to Omnium business strategy – optimizing technology sequencing and delivery.  The candidate will need to have the ability to support production releases which may be during standard business hours, after hours, and/or weekends.
** Major Duties:
*** Provide release related support for multiple Technology teams
* Confirm that Fixed Versions are created in ADO and that User Stories are associated to the Fix Version
* Coordinate with Release Management and Omnium Support teams for code deployments into INT and Production environments
* Ensure that all test plan and approval/signoff documentation required for Production releases are uploaded into the Release Management tool
* Plan and coordinate pre-release and in-flight release activities; including creating release runbooks (as needed), facilitate preparation calls with key stakeholders, and provide regular stakeholder status updates
* Track release progress, manage risks, and resolve issues that affect release scope, schedule, and quality
* Complete post release activities such as the closure of INT and PROD Service Now requests and Release Management UI (Bi-Frost) package cleanup
* Demonstrate leadership throughout the testing cycles; effectively lead meetings, drive agendas, set expectations, hold team accountable for results, be proactive on execution and follow-up on takeaways
* Participate in release retrospectives monthly to identify lessons learned and to foster an environment of continuous improvement for testing and release management workflows
* Identify broken processes and recommend process improvements to streamline and optimize delivery execution
* Use sound judgement to escalate issues appropriately and timely, including solution options and associated impacts to drive effective decision making
* Demonstrate critical thinking to anticipate and connect opportunities and resolve challenges / escalations.
* Demonstrate strong collaboration with others and high emotional intelligence to build productive and strategic relationships
* Self-starter, performs independently with limited coaching, leads peers, and consults with shared services teams across HFS & NT to solve issues
